<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>faemino.net &#187; idiomas</title>
	<atom:link href="http://www.faemino.net/programacion/etiquetas/idiomas/feed/" rel="self" type="application/rss+xml" />
	<link>http://www.faemino.net/programacion</link>
	<description>PHP, CakePHP y otras cosas más</description>
	<lastBuildDate>Thu, 03 Jun 2010 08:27:17 +0000</lastBuildDate>
	<generator>http://wordpress.org/?v=2.8.6</generator>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
			<item>
		<title>CakePHP: Poner el idioma en la URI</title>
		<link>http://www.faemino.net/programacion/cakephp-poner-el-idioma-en-la-uri/</link>
		<comments>http://www.faemino.net/programacion/cakephp-poner-el-idioma-en-la-uri/#comments</comments>
		<pubDate>Thu, 07 Feb 2008 18:05:47 +0000</pubDate>
		<dc:creator>faemino</dc:creator>
				<category><![CDATA[CakePHP]]></category>
		<category><![CDATA[idiomas]]></category>
		<category><![CDATA[routes]]></category>

		<guid isPermaLink="false">http://www.faemino.net/cakephp-poner-el-idioma-en-la-uri/</guid>
		<description><![CDATA[Buscando cómo poner el idioma en el que se está navegando la web como parte de la URI, he encontrado un hilo en el google groups de CakePHP dónde explica una manera de conseguirlo.
En nuestro archivo routes.php
Router::connect('/:language/:controller/:action/*', array(), array('language' =&#62; '[a-z]{2}'));
Luego en el controlador que queramos, preferiblemente en el app_controller, en el método beforeFilter podemos [...]]]></description>
			<content:encoded><![CDATA[<p>Buscando cómo poner el idioma en el que se está navegando la web como parte de la URI, he encontrado <a href="http://groups.google.com/group/cake-php/browse_thread/thread/10b2b92dc44ec90d/99391ca12c765749?lnk=gst&amp;q=routes+language#99391ca12c765749">un hilo en el google groups de CakePHP dónde explica una manera de conseguirlo</a>.</p>
<p>En nuestro archivo routes.php</p>
<pre><code>Router::connect('/:language/:controller/:action/*', array(), array('language' =&gt; '[a-z]{2}'));</code></pre>
<p>Luego en el controlador que queramos, preferiblemente en el app_controller, en el método beforeFilter podemos obtener ese valor de la URI, por si lo necesitamos, mediante:</p>
<pre><code>$this-&gt;params['language'];</code></pre>
]]></content:encoded>
			<wfw:commentRss>http://www.faemino.net/programacion/cakephp-poner-el-idioma-en-la-uri/feed/</wfw:commentRss>
		<slash:comments>2</slash:comments>
		</item>
	</channel>
</rss>
